devServer.proxy 在查阅了webpack官网中devServer.proxy的内容后,发现这个devServer是用了http-proxy-middleware包去实现的,并且给出了它的官方文档 http-proxy-middleware 在http-proxy-middleware中发现了这样一个router配置参数,意思是可以针对特殊的一些请求重新定位/代理 option.router: object/function, re-target o...
module.exports = function (app) { app.use( // 代理 1 proxy.createProxyMiddleware('/api', { // 匹配到 '/api' 前缀的请求,就会触发该代理配置 target: 'http://127.0.0.1:6000/api', // 请求转发地址 changeOrigin: true, // 是否跨域 /* changeOrigin 为 true 时,服务器收到的请求头中的host...
proxy写在src/setupProxy.js 中,其实修改的是devServer的before配置,而不是proxy,最后会走Server.js...
devServer其实是用的 http-proxy-middleware 中的配置,之前一直不晓得在哪看proxy的详细配置,现在发现其实只要参考http-proxy-middleware的配置项即可,本地代理能自由组合了。 https://github.com/chimurai/http-proxy-middleware#options http-proxy-middleware的pathFilter就是我们常用的这种格式中的'/abc': proxy: {...
一、vite在根目录下的 vite.config.ts或vite.config.js文件中配置export default defineConfig({ server: { proxy: { "/api": { target: "http://xxx/api", changeOrigin: true, ws: true, // 允…
//后端proxy代理const proxy = require('http-proxy-middleware'); app.use('/api',proxy({ target:'http://47.95.113.63/ssr'})) 使用代理之后服务端异常,因为我们服务端请求相当于是 :服务端根路径+/api/news.json?secret=PP87ANTIPIRATE;所以我们需要对服务端和浏览器端采用不同的请求路径 ...
React Server Components手把手教学 Rust学习笔记 而如果想使用RSC,就需要使用Next.js的最新版本。而今天,我们做一次技术尝试。 「用Rust搭建适配RSC的Web服务器」。 我们在致所有渴望学习Rust的人的信中也介绍过,Rust在Web开发中也能大放异彩。 最近,在评论区,有些人说Rust在国内的工作岗位少,其实如果大家细心去...
"proxy": "http://localhost:5000/" 到package.json,甚至 devServer: { historyApiFallback: true, proxy: { "/": "http://localhost:5000" } } to webpack.config.dev.js 但是,这些似乎都不起作用。当我转到localhost:3000/age(我的一个路由)时,后端没有收到任何请求,即使 React 组件绑定到它,并且...
用Rust搭建React Server Components 的Web服务器 ❝ 凡心所向,素履以往,生如逆旅,一苇以航 ❞ 大家好,我是「柒八九」。 前言 在前面的文章中,我们介绍过React的RSC和Rust。 React Server Components手把手教学 Rust学习笔记 而如果想使用RSC,就需要使用Next.js的最新版本。而今天,我们做一次技术尝试。
所以我们接下来提到的状态是针对react component这种有限状态机。而数据就广泛了,它不光是指server层返回给前端的数据,react中的状态也是一种数据。当我们改变数据的同时,就要通过改变状态去引发界面的变更。 我们真正要关心的是数据层的管理,我们今天所讨论的数据流管理方案,特别是后面介绍的几种第三方库,不光是配合...